Poor old Kimi, he seems to look a shadow of the man who won last years world title in dramatic fashion at Interlagos last year. In a rare moment when he ditched his image of 'Iceman' Raikkonen admitted he now needs a miracle to retain his world title. Raikkonen is 21 points behind Lewis Hamilton and 20 behind fellow Ferrari team mate Felipe Massa. Raikkonen could find it tough keeping hold of 4th place with Nick Heidfeld only 4 points behind him.

The rumours of him departing Ferrari are starting to appear. Despite Ferrari 'claiming' Kimi will be wearing red next year, many believe he could leave, which could pave the way for Alonso to make his dream move to Ferrari. Raikkonen was popular at Mclaren but it seems very unlikely he will go back as Hamilton and Kovalainen will both be driving for McLaren next year.

Raikkonen is starting to show he feels the pressure of not winning since the Spanish Grand Prix, which was 10 races ago. It is also known Raikkonen does not wish to just sit back and help Massa try and win the title, despite the fact Massa dropped back for Raikkonen at last years Interlagos.
